Although it was initially only used in web browsers, JavaScript engines have since been put to use as servers with Node. JavaScript also uses asynchronous calls to fetch data from web services in the background. Web browsers are able to interpret it, and when triggered by events, modify the HTML and CSS of a web page with dynamic updates. JavaScript allows you to create and control content dynamically on a web page without requiring a page reload. It started as the programming language for the web and is one of the three layers of standard web technologies - the other two being HTML and CSS.
